Exploring the Concept of Legal Aid in Hart County GA

Legal aid in Hart County GA is a crucial service that plays a crucial role in ensuring access to justice for individuals who would otherwise be unable to afford legal representation and advice. It acts as a cornerstone in upholding the principle that all individuals, irrespective of their financial means, should have access to legal assistance and protections. This article examines the idea of legal aid, its value, the different forms it takes, and the challenges it faces.

Comprehending Legal Aid

Legal help in Hart County GA refers to services offered to support individuals in navigating the legal system, including legal defense, counsel, and insight. These services are typically provided to those with limited financial resources who are unable to afford private attorneys.

Importance of Legal Aid in Hart County GA

Ensuring Justice Access: Legal aid helps bridge the gap between people who have the means for legal services and people who lack the means. Without legal aid services, many people would be left to face legal challenges alone, potentially causing inequitable results. Legal assistance guarantees fairness and equity in the legal system for everyone.

Protection of Rights:

Legal aid plays a pivotal role in defending people’s rights. For instance, in criminal matters, the availability of a defense lawyer is essential to ensuring that the accused receives a fair trial. In non-criminal disputes, legal assistance can help people settle conflicts, get accommodation, and obtain necessary benefits.

Social Impact:

By providing legal support to those in need, legal assistance services enhance societal stability. When people can settle their legal problems, they are more capable of concentrating on other life aspects, such as work and family. This, in turn, results in more robust and stable communities.

Forms of Legal Aid

Legal aid can take different forms, depending on the type of legal problem and the available resources. Some of the frequent forms include:

Court Representation:

This entails assigning a lawyer to advocate for someone in court. This is especially critical in criminal cases, where the outcome can have a major effect on someone’s life and freedom.

Legal Advice and Counseling:

Various legal aid entities offer advice and counseling services to assist people in comprehending their legal rights and choices. This can include assistance with creating legal documents or providing guidance on how to proceed with a legal matter.

Volunteer Legal Services:

Pro bono assistance are provided by private lawyers who donate their time to provide free legal assistance to individuals in need. Various law firms and individual lawyers take on pro bono cases as part of their dedication to public service.

Legal Clinics:

Legal aid clinics are often administered by law schools or charitable organizations and give free or low-fee legal assistance to the community. These clinics may specialize in particular areas of law, such as family-related legal matters or immigration.

Online Resources:

With the rise of technology, many legal aid organizations now give web-based resources, including legal data, do-it-yourself guides, and digital consultations. These resources can be particularly helpful for individuals who may not have easy access to brick-and-mortar legal aid offices.

Issues Confronting Legal Aid

Although it is crucial, legal support services encounter various obstacles:

Supply and Demand Imbalance:

The demand for legal aid services regularly outstrips the supply. This means that numerous people who require legal aid may not be able to obtain it quickly, or ever. This discrepancy can lead to overburdened legal aid attorneys and longer wait times for clients.

Understanding:

Many people are often unaware about the accessibility of legal aid services. Numerous people who would benefit from legal assistance may not be aware that these services are available or how to get them. Raising awareness among the public is essential for more people to benefit from these services.

Regional Disparities:

Legal aid access can differ greatly based on geographic location. Rural areas, in particular, may have less legal aid availability compared to urban areas, leading to inequalities in access to justice.

In Conclusion

Legal aid is a critical element of a just and fair legal system. By providing legal support to those who cannot afford it, legal aid guarantees that fairness and justice are maintained.
